A garden window projects out from the wall of the house. It has
four window units. The two ventilating side units are
trapezoidal casement units that open outwards with a crank. The
center unit and the roof are picture windows.
The insulated glazed roof is designed to to be weather tight and
leak proof. It's called a garden window because it provides an
ideal environment for growing plants indoors.
